My wife is a big Nora Roberts fan, so when i saw this book pop up in the half-price sale i purchased. I write this review after listening to all three books in this series so will try not to leave many spoilers. This is an end of the world book with a series of struggles between good and evil, or light and dark. Magical abilities have awoken in many of the survivors with some embracing the light and others turning to the dark. The story follows three different groups of these survivors as they flee New York city and eventually meet up at a little town in Virginia that they name "New Hope". The characters are likable and develop strong friendships as they struggle to build a new community. Book 1 ends with the birth of "The One", Fallon Swift, a young girl that is prophesized to lead the forces of light to vanquish the dark. Nora Roberts writes with this story with a lot of emotion. Her characters are well developed and give the listener a sense that they too could be friends. Julia Whelan's performance is outstanding as she brings the many characters to life. Book 2 follows Fallon's magical training and her journey to New Hope and her struggles as she assumes the leadership role in the conflict against the dark. Book 3 chronicles a series of major battles that eventually wind back to the beginning and climax with the final battle between light and dark. The pace of these books is fairly quick, and Nora doesn't get bogged down with long descriptions of the battles but focuses on character's emotions and interactions during and after.

I started with the free books in the Plus Catalogue, enjoyed them so much that i bought extra credits and finished the entire series in a week or so. Jace and Abigail are very strong characters and easy to like. The Nameless book provides the back story for Abigail. Jace's back story is given in snippets throughout this series. This story follows the Hero's Arc outline, flawed characters facing overwhelming odds and achieving greatness in the struggle. The ending is very satisfying and leaves the reader feeling good about the lengthy time investment in the story. I gave the story four stars because it tended to lag in several places. The story arc circled itself is several places, such as the ring worlds, and i felt that the author was just adding chapters to fill out the book. Also, at times Jace is completely trusting of his path and follows his instincts without hesitation, at other times he pulls back and wastes hours contemplating whether or not to continue the path. For instance, entering the Precursor Artifact to activate the weapon. Luke Daniels narration is great and brings all the characters to life with different voices and emotions. I will definitely be looking for other books with his narration. One note for Audible is that the 12-hour format of the publisher's pack format should have expanded to include more books in each pack: perhaps four books instead of two. The current format is rather expensive, and you have to juggle the decision of extra credits or a 6-month comment if you choose to only use your monthly credits.

I feel cheated by this book. Sorry for the spoilers, but the ending of this book caught me by surprise. I have followed Mr. Wong through all six books and loved the way the author wrapped up the storyline in each of the previous five with a fairly good positive ending. Throughout this book we struggled with our hero not being able to see that he walked away from his soul mate early in the story when he moved off his old ship to start his "Owner's Share" journey. After a long, slow, series of events they finally reunite for a few chapters only to have her tragically killed off. The story throws in a plot twist to attempt an explanation for this event and ends rather abruptly without bringing closure for any of the characters. I started this series by listening to the first two books from the Plus Catalog then purchasing the next four, so my investment for this series was almost $50. Maybe I am just a sucker for fairy tale type endings, but this book left me feeling depressed and wanting a more positive outcome.
